
Forgiveness and Forward Movement
Love and joy are a part of life, but so are more negative experiences like heartbreak and hurt. Over the course of our lives we’ll meet untold numbers of people, some of whom will enrich our lives and make it more fulfilling. On the other hand, there are people who will either intentionally or unwittingly leave us hurting and break our hearts. Although the pain may ebb with time, the resentment can linger.
Negative Effects of Clinging to Resentment
Often people cling to anger and resentment because in some illogical way we view these emotions as being representative of punishing the person who hurt us. While we may move on, it’s sometimes difficult to forgive someone because to do so feels as those it’s a mark of weakness. Consequently, we may convince ourselves that forgiving someone is tantamount to condoning his or her hurtful actions…
